Low field-nuclear magnetic resonance (LF-NMR) relaxation characteristics of glyceride mixture can be used in rapid monitoring and product analysis of lipid remodeling processes. In this study, the LF-NMR relaxation properties of single or mixed glyceryl oleate with different esterification degrees were studied. The results indicated that three peaks appeared in the T2 relaxation map of glyceryl oleate. With increasing esterification degree or temperature, both the single component and multi-component relaxation time increased, and the ratios of peak area changed as well. The higher the esterification degree was, the larger the relaxation time changed. For the binary or ternary mixed glyceryl oleate systems, with the glycerol trioleate (GTO) ratio increased to 40%, the single and multi-component relaxation time, the peak area proportion S22 all increased, while the peak area proportion S23 decreased. Principal components analysis (PCA) showed that the LF-NMR relaxation characteristics of ternary system had regular distribution on the score plot with changing GTO ratio and glycerol dioleate (GDO)/glycerol monooleate(GMO) ratio.
